#1f6416 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f6416 is composed of 12.2% red, 39.2% green and 8.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69% cyan, 0% magenta, 78%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 113.1 degrees, a saturation of 63.9% and a lightness of 23.9%. #1f6416 color hex could be obtained by blending #3ec82c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

Shades and Tints of #1f6416
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010401 is the darkest color, while #f4fcf2 is the lightest one.
